EarlyAct Club of Parental Care Nursery and Primary School Bushenyi Charters New Leadership and Launches Community Project Bushenyi, Uganda

June 19, 2025

A day of celebration and commitment unfolded at Parental Care Nursery and Primary School Bushenyi as its EarlyAct Club officially installed its new president and committee, marking a significant milestone with the club’s chartering.

The event, brimming with youthful enthusiasm and seasoned leadership, saw the club members pledge to a year of service and community impact.

The ceremony was graced by notable figures, including Prisca Kyomukama, the President-Elect of the Rotary Club of Bushenyi, and Agness Nantale, the Assistant District Governor.

Also in attendance was Sister Nuwamanya Ephrance, a revered senior citizen. The esteemed Mayor of Bushenyi-Ishaka Municipality served as the guest of honor, underscoring the importance of youth involvement in civic life.

A highlight of the day was the announcement by the newly installed EarlyAct Club president of their ambitious project: providing scholastic materials to orphaned and underprivileged children in Kyamuhunga.

Demonstrating their dedication, the club has already collected 10 dozens of books, 10 boxes of pens, and 20 sets of mathematical instruments for this noble cause.

In her remarks, Ms. Nantale Agnes extended her heartfelt gratitude to the school directors for their unwavering support of the EarlyAct Club, promising her continued presence and assistance whenever needed.

Ms. Prisca Kyomukama echoed these sentiments, commending Parental Care Nursery and Primary School for laying a strong foundation for its pupils and pledging further support to the club’s endeavors.

The Mayor briefly talked about the beginnings of the school and lauded the founder Nshemereirwe Elivaida for her great work in promoting Excellence in both academic and extra curricular performance in The Municipality, the Country and Beyond.

The event concluded with vibrant entertainment and refreshments, creating a joyous atmosphere that celebrated both the formal establishment of the EarlyAct Club and the promising future of its young leaders in serving their community.
